To confirm the actual remaining ink, visually check the ink levels in the ink tanks. You see a window like this: 2. Note: The ink levels displayed are an estimate and may differ from the actual ink remaining in the ink tanks. Refill any ink tank or replace the maintenance box as needed. Continued use of the product when the ink level is below the lower line on the tank could damage the product. 246
